What does POTHOLE mean?
POTHOLE noun- A shallow pit or other edged depression in a road's surface, especially when caused by erosion by weather or traffic.
- A pit formed in the bed of a turbulent stream.
- A vertical cave system, often found in limestone.
- A pit resulting from unauthorized excavation by treasure hunters or vandals.
- A hole or recess on the top of a stove into which a pot may be placed.
